Smart Client Deployment with ClickOnce(TM): Deploying Windows Forms Applications with ClickOnce(TM)

Microsoft’s new ClickOnce auto-updating technology can radically simplify application deployment. Using it, .NET developers and architects can deliver a powerful, smart client experience along with the easy maintenance of today’s best Web applications.

Microsoft Regional Director and MVP Brian Noyes has unsurpassed experience previewing and teaching ClickOnce to professional developers. In Smart Client Deployment with ClickOnce, Noyes demonstrates exactly how to make the most of ClickOnce in your real-world enterprise applications. Noyes covers ClickOnce design, architecture, security, installation, updates, and Bootstrapping—each with a full case study and detailed sample code.

This focused, concise book explains how to

  • Design client applications for efficient deployment and auto-updating
  • Perform application deployments and automatic updates quickly and easily
  • Deliver “on-demand” client application updates
  • Deploy prerequisites with the Visual Studio 2005 Bootstrapper
  • Take full control of ClickOnce’s powerful publishing, update, and security options
  • Leverage the Visual Studio 2005 and .NET 2.0 platform features that make ClickOnce possible
  • Understand how your application will behave in the ClickOnce runtime environment
